Recommended Bike Rack for Camper Van with Rear Spare Tire
Question:
I have a Leisure Travel van, 2000 that is on a Dodge 3500 chassis. It has a 2inch receiver and has a spare tire mounted on the rear door. The end of the hitch to the spare tire end is 8 inches. Will the Yakima or Thule bike racks fit? I am looking at the hanging type carrier. Thank You
asked by: Myron V
Helpful Expert Reply:
The distance from the center of the hitch pin hole to the back of the upright post on the Thule Hitching Post Pro part # TH934XTR is 13-1/2" so there won't be any issues using this rack on a camper van with rear spare tire. It's our most popular hanging style rack and what I recommend using.
